Winchester Has Two Positions Open

The Winchester Finance Committee and Personnel Board are seeking new members.

Winchester is seeking two positions to fill this year: members for the Finance Committee and Personnel Board.

See the descriptions for each vacancy below.

Finance Committee:

Who: One registered voter who holds no other town office can apply to serve on the committee for a term to expire 2013.

What: The Finance Committee annually reviews the Town Manager’s proposed budget. After review and public hearing, the Committee prepares its recommended budget for town meeting action. The Committee also prepares recommendations on all town meeting articles involving expenditure of town funds.

Appointments to this committee are made jointly by the Town Moderator, the Chairman of the Board of Selectmen,and the Chairman of the Finance Committee.

When: A major time commitment is expected of the members from mid-February through May. Two evening meetings per week, as well as sub-committee meetings, occur during that time.

Personnel Board:

Who: The Personnel Board seeks one member to serve for a three-year term ending June, 30 2015.

What: The Personnel Board serves in an advisory capacity to town agencies and the Town Manager. Duties include assistance in the coordination of collective bargaining activities, as well as making recommendations on compensation and personnel policies.

Members are appointed by a committee of three: the Town Moderator, the Chairman of the Board of Selectmen and the Chairman of the School Committee.

When: This is a three-year term that ends June 30, 2015.

Deadline: Interested persons can send a resume and a letter of interest to the address below by Friday, Oct. 5.
